Makes 26 servings, 1 topped cracker each.
Break up 24 crackers coarsely.
Mix cream cheese and marshmallow creme in medium bowl until blended. Gently stir in whipped topping and broken crackers.
Scoop cream cheese mixture into 26 balls, each about 1-1/2 inches in diameter; place on parchment-covered rimmed baking sheet. Top with sprinkles.
Freeze 4 hours or until firm.
Serve frozen cream cheese balls on remaining crackers.
Prepare recipe as directed, except do not freeze the cream cheese balls. Instead, refrigerate them 2 hours or until chilled before serving on the remaining crackers.
